2401_84404545 2024-04-16 11:11 采纳率: 100%
浏览 6
已结题

在使用CH341SER.EXE时不小心把所有驱动文件删除了怎么解决

当插入鼠标时,设备管理器也没有端口选项,进行烧录时识别不出芯片

img


img

  • 写回答

9条回答 默认 最新

  • 阿里嘎多学长 2024-04-16 11:11
    关注

    以下内容由CHATGPT及阿里嘎多学长共同生成、有用望采纳:


    您在CSDN问答中提出的问题涉及到在使用CH341SER.EXE时不小心删除了所有驱动文件,导致无法正常使用STM32进行烧录的问题。根据您提供的链接内容,以下是对您问题的分析和解题思路:

    问题分析

    1. 设备管理器没有端口选项:这表明操作系统无法识别USB转串口设备,可能是因为驱动文件被删除或未正确安装。
    2. 烧录时识别不出芯片:由于STM32需要通过串口与计算机通信,驱动文件的缺失导致计算机无法与STM32建立连接,因此无法进行烧录。

    问题出现原因

    • 可能在操作过程中不小心删除了CH341SER.EXE相关的驱动文件,或者之前的驱动安装不完整或损坏。

    解题思路

    1. 重新安装驱动:访问CH341SER.EXE的官方网站或使用随设备附带的驱动安装盘重新安装驱动。
    2. 检查设备管理器:安装驱动后,检查设备管理器中是否出现了新的端口选项,如“USB转串口”等。
    3. 测试连接:使用STM32连接到计算机,尝试进行烧录操作,看是否能够成功识别芯片。

    代码修改与解释

    由于您的问题主要涉及硬件驱动的安装,而非代码编写,因此没有具体的代码修改部分。但是,如果您在烧录过程中使用了某些软件或脚本,可能需要检查这些软件或脚本是否因驱动问题而无法正常工作。

    最终运行结果

    按照上述解题思路操作后,您应该能够在设备管理器中看到STM32设备,并能够通过烧录软件成功烧录程序到STM32芯片上。如果问题依旧存在,可能需要进一步检查硬件连接、尝试在不同计算机上进行测试,或者联系设备供应商获取技术支持。

    请注意,解决此类问题通常需要一定的硬件知识和操作系统知识。如果上述步骤无法解决问题,建议寻求专业人士的帮助。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论 编辑记录
查看更多回答(8条)

报告相同问题?

问题事件

  • 系统已结题 4月24日
  • 已采纳回答 4月16日
  • 创建了问题 4月16日

悬赏问题

  • ¥15 基于作物生长模型下,有限水资源的最大化粮食产量的资源优化模型建立
  • ¥20 关于变压器的具体案例分析
  • ¥15 生成的QRCode圖片加上下載按鈕
  • ¥15 板材切割优化算法,数学建模,python,lingo
  • ¥15 科来模拟ARP欺骗困惑求解
  • ¥100 iOS开发关于快捷指令截屏后如何将截屏(或从截屏中提取出的文本)回传给本应用并打开指定页面
  • ¥15 unity连接Sqlserver
  • ¥15 图中这种约束条件lingo该怎么表示出来
  • ¥15 VSCode里的Prettier如何实现等式赋值后的对齐效果?
  • ¥20 keepalive配置业务服务双机单活的方法。业务服务一定是要双机单活的方式